Abstract

본 고안은 각도조절이 가능한 관이음구조에 관한 것으로, 특히 고정연결유닛(3)에 유니언너트(2-1)에 의해 결합되는 호스연결유닛(5)의 실링부(1)가 구면으로 형성되는 것을 특징으로 하는 각도조절이 가능한 관이음구조에 관한 것이다.The present invention relates to a pipe joint structure capable of adjusting the angle, in particular the sealing portion (1) of the hose connection unit 5 is coupled to the fixed connection unit 3 by the union nut (2-1) is formed in a spherical surface It relates to a pipe joint structure capable of adjusting the angle.

Description

각도조절이 가능한 관이음 구조{pipe connector device}Pipe connector device with adjustable angle {pipe connector device}

본 고안은 각도조절이 가능한 관이음구조에 관한 것으로, 특히 고정연결너트에 유니언너트에 의해 결합되는 호스연결너트의 실링부를 구형으로 형성하여 고정연결너트와 선접촉케하는 각도조절이 가능한 관이음구조에 관한 것이다.The present invention relates to an angle adjustable pipe joint structure, in particular the pipe joint structure that can be adjusted in line with the fixed connection nut by forming a sealing portion of the hose connection nut coupled to the fixed connection nut by the union nut in a spherical shape It is about.

종래의 관이음구조는 도 1에 도시한 바와 같이, 고정연결너트(3)에 호스연결너트(4)이 유니언너트(2)에 동일축을 이루도록 연결되어 있고, 호스가 결합되는 호스연결너트는 용도에 따라 직선관 또는 45°, 60°, 90° 등의 엘보관이 사용된다.In the conventional pipe joint structure, as shown in FIG. 1, the hose connection nut 4 is connected to the fixed connection nut 3 to form the same axis as the union nut 2, and the hose connection nut to which the hose is coupled is used. Depending on the straight pipe or elbows such as 45 °, 60 °, 90 ° is used.

이처럼 고정연결너트(3)에 동일축을 이루도록 고정 결합되는 호스연결너트(4)는 제한된 규격의 제품만 사용 가능하기 때문에 중간의 각도를 필요로 하는 경우 호스를 필요한 만큼 길게 돌려가게 되어 대단히 불편하다.As such, the hose connection nut 4 fixedly coupled to the fixed connection nut 3 to form the same axis can be used only in a limited standard product, so when the intermediate angle is required, the hose is turned as long as necessary, which is very inconvenient.

본 고안은 고정연결너트에 유니언너트에 의해 결합되는 호스연결너트의 실링부를 구형으로 형성하여 고정연결너트와 선접촉케함으로써 호스연결너트를 임의 방향으로 회전할 수 있는 각도조절이 가능한 관이음구조를 제공함에 그 목적이 있다.The present invention forms a sealing portion of the hose connection nut coupled by the union nut to the fixed connection nut to make a linear contact with the fixed connection nut by the pipe joint structure that can adjust the angle to rotate the hose connection nut in any direction The purpose is to provide.

도면을 참조하여 본 고안을 설명한다.The present invention will be described with reference to the drawings.

도2는 본 고안에 따른 각도조절이 가능한 관이음구조를 나타내는 단면도이다.Figure 2 is a cross-sectional view showing a pipe structure capable of adjusting the angle according to the present invention.

고정연결너트(3)에 유니언너트(2-1)에 의해 결합되는 호스연결너트(5)는 유니언너트(2-1)에 내장되면서 고정연결너트(3)의 일단면과 접촉하는 실링부(1)가 구면으로 형성되어 있다.The hose connection nut 5 coupled to the fixed connection nut 3 by the union nut 2-1 is embedded in the union nut 2-1 while being in contact with one end surface of the fixed connection nut 3 ( 1) is formed into a spherical surface.

이때, 실링부(1)는 종래와 달리 유니언너트(2-1)의 내측면 및 고정연결너트(3)의 일단면과 선접촉(a,b)이 이루어지기 때문에, 고정연결너트(3) 외측면에 형성된 나사부와 유니언너트(2-1) 내측면에 형성된 나사부를 체결시킴에 따라, 호스연결너트(5)의 구형상의 실링부(1)와 고정연결너트(3)의 선접촉부(a)와 유니언너트(2-1)의 선접촉부(b)에서는 실링과 체결력을 동시에 갖출 수 있게 된다.At this time, since the sealing portion 1 is in contact with the inner surface of the union nut (2-1) and one end surface of the fixed connection nut (3), the fixed connection nut (3) unlike the prior art As the screw portion formed on the outer surface and the screw portion formed on the inner surface of the union nut 2-1 are fastened, the spherical sealing portion 1 of the hose connecting nut 5 and the line contact portion of the fixed connecting nut 3 ) And the line contact portion (b) of the union nut (2-1) can be provided with a sealing and a fastening force at the same time.

즉, 고정연결너트(3)의 일면에 동심축을 가진 테이퍼면(3a)이 형성되고, 그 테이퍼면(3a)에 호스연결너트(5)에 형성된 구형상의 실링부(1)가 접촉되는 경우, 이들의 접촉면에는 원형의 선접촉부(a)를 형성하게되며, 구형의 실링부(1)는 임의의 접속각도에서도 원형의 선접촉부(a)를 형성할 수 있도록 하여 소정의 접속각도에서도 실링이 가능하게 된다.That is, when a tapered surface 3a having a concentric shaft is formed on one surface of the fixed connection nut 3 and the spherical sealing portion 1 formed on the hose connection nut 5 is in contact with the tapered surface 3a, On the contact surface thereof, a circular line contact portion (a) is formed, and the spherical sealing portion (1) can be formed at a predetermined connection angle by allowing the circular line contact portion (a) to be formed at any connection angle. Done.

또한, 유니언너트(2-1) 내측면에 형성된 동심축을 갖는 페이퍼면(2a)상에 구형상의 호스연결너트(5)가 원형의 선접촉부(b)를 가지게되며, 이 선접촉부(b)는 구면상에서 임의의 각도에서도 동일한 체결력을 전달하게 된다.Further, a spherical hose connecting nut 5 has a circular line contact portion b on a paper surface 2a having a concentric shaft formed on the inner surface of the union nut 2-1, and the line contact portion b is The same fastening force is transmitted at any angle on the sphere.

한편, 상기 호스연결너트(5)는 단부에 형성된 구형상의 실링부(1)에 의해 유니언너트(2-1)의 내측면 및 고정연결너트(3)의 일단부와 선접촉을 하게 되므로 체결력을 낮출 수 있음은 물론 이다.On the other hand, the hose connecting nut (5) is in contact with the inner surface of the union nut (2-1) and one end of the fixed connection nut (3) by the spherical sealing portion (1) formed at the end so that the tightening force Of course it can be lowered.

따라서, 호스연결너트(5)는 실링부(1)의 구면에 의해 소정접속각도범위내에서 회전이 가능하고, 이로써 주위의 어떤 각도의 간섭물도 효과적으로 간섭받지않고 관이음 작업을 할 수 있게 된다.Therefore, the hose connecting nut 5 can be rotated within a predetermined connection angle range by the spherical surface of the sealing portion 1, thereby enabling the pipe joint work without effectively interfering any angle of the surroundings.

본 고안은 고정연결너트에 유니언너트에 의해 결합되는 호스연결너트의 실링부를 구형으로 형성하여 유니언너트 및 고정연결너트와 선접촉케함으로써 호스연결너트를 임의 방향으로 회전할 수 있고, 이로써 주위의 간섭물을 효과적으로 피하여 작업을 함으로써 작업의 생산성을 향상시킬 수 있는 효과를 제공한다.The present invention is to form a sealing portion of the hose connection nut is coupled to the fixed connection nut by the union nut to make a linear contact with the union nut and the fixed connection nut to rotate the hose connection nut in any direction, thereby causing interference around Working effectively avoiding water provides the effect of improving the productivity of the work.
